diff options
author | Charles Otto <ottochar@gmail.com> | 2009-11-15 00:58:40 -0500 |
---|---|---|
committer | Charles Otto <ottochar@gmail.com> | 2009-11-15 23:46:26 -0500 |
commit | bd50c076d36322b58a7231a2300d1f391846da87 (patch) | |
tree | 6eeba8182133bd7ce2a2980d509f7034c48bb9f1 /crawl-ref/source/spells4.cc | |
parent | b9151ca4e5fe8245f00cc998eb8179e6146b4a54 (diff) | |
download | crawl-ref-bd50c076d36322b58a7231a2300d1f391846da87.tar.gz crawl-ref-bd50c076d36322b58a7231a2300d1f391846da87.zip |
Modify temporary brand spells to be delay based
Diffstat (limited to 'crawl-ref/source/spells4.cc')
-rw-r--r-- | crawl-ref/source/spells4.cc | 9 |
1 files changed, 5 insertions, 4 deletions
diff --git a/crawl-ref/source/spells4.cc b/crawl-ref/source/spells4.cc index 68c61ad0f9..3c934eb81e 100644 --- a/crawl-ref/source/spells4.cc +++ b/crawl-ref/source/spells4.cc @@ -611,11 +611,12 @@ void cast_ignite_poison(int pow) you.weapon()->name(DESC_CAP_YOUR).c_str()); you.wield_change = true; - you.duration[DUR_WEAPON_BRAND] += - 1 + you.duration[DUR_WEAPON_BRAND] / 2; + int increase = (1 + you.duration[DUR_WEAPON_BRAND]/2) + * BASELINE_DELAY; + you.duration[DUR_WEAPON_BRAND] += increase; - if (you.duration[DUR_WEAPON_BRAND] > 80) - you.duration[DUR_WEAPON_BRAND] = 80; + if (you.duration[DUR_WEAPON_BRAND] > 80 * BASELINE_DELAY) + you.duration[DUR_WEAPON_BRAND] = 80 * BASELINE_DELAY; } } |